Vladimír Balik is a scholar working on Surgery, Neurology and Pathology and Forensic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Vladimír Balik has authored 36 papers receiving a total of 312 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 17 papers in Surgery, 13 papers in Neurology and 10 papers in Pathology and Forensic Medicine. Recurrent topics in Vladimír Balik's work include Meningioma and schwannoma management (9 papers), Spinal Cord Injury Research (7 papers) and Spinal Fractures and Fixation Techniques (7 papers). Vladimír Balik is often cited by papers focused on Meningioma and schwannoma management (9 papers), Spinal Cord Injury Research (7 papers) and Spinal Fractures and Fixation Techniques (7 papers). Vladimír Balik collaborates with scholars based in Czechia, Slovakia and Japan. Vladimír Balik's co-authors include I Šulla, Miroslav Vaverka, Lumír Hrabálek, Josef Srovnal, Marián Hajdúch, Ondřej Kalita, Katsumi Takizawa, Marek Šarišský, Hanna Lehto and Ladislav Mirossay and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Annals of Oncology and Neurosurgery.
